OPINION: Mogul was designed for WM5!

I've jumped back and forth between custom WM6 and WM5 roms, and after a few days of using WM5 (sampson's clean, rev 00 [because rev 01 kept hard resetting at random]), I am convinced! I used to live with WM6 and its lag, believing that was just how it is, but WM5 really opened my eyes. It is at least twice as fast. Sliding used to take like 3 seconds with WM6, but with WM5 it takes less than a second. Scrolling pages on IE used to be terrible on WM6, so choppy that text becomes unreadable even when scrolling at a slow rate. Not so with WM5: pages scroll smooth and quick, and more importantly, you can actually read while you scroll. Of course, these are minor details (major selling points for me), but overall, it feels much snappier and more responsive. There seems to be a very tiny memory leak, but nowhere as bad as it was with WM6. Example: I started at about 28MB in the morning, was about 23MB last time I checked. But even with multiple apps running, there doesn't seem to be any noticable lag (compared to WM6, which would literally freeze when you run more than three apps).

There are a few setbacks, such as the last-gen graphics and an older version of IE, but these are subtle differences, and WM5 operates pretty much just like WM6. However, I am still in search of a working smart dialer to go along with the Touch dialer I installed.

If you haven't tried WM5, and are willing to experiment, I strongly encourage you to give it a shot.
